**Mgmt Meeting Minutes — Retiring the Brightline Range**

Quick recap for sales leads at Fenholt Supplies: we agreed to retire the Brightline fixture range by year-end. Remaining stock moves to clearance pricing next month, and accounts on standing orders get migrated to the Lumetta range. Trade-in incentives were approved in principle. The confidential note on next steps sits just below.

board note of bajof-bajeg: The pricing group signed off on a budget of $13.4 million for Project Sildor. The renewal with Lamixek Holdings closes at $48.9 million a year, 49 percent above the last contract.

### Quillpress renderer: bounded parsing

This PR hardens the markdown pipeline against pathological input — deeply nested blockquotes and giant reference-link tables were pinning render workers for seconds. Parsing now runs with hard depth and size limits, and anything over budget falls back to escaped plaintext instead of timing out the request. On-call folks: if you see a spike in fallback renders after deploy, the limits are probably too tight for real documents, not an attack. The enforced limits are defined below.

tuning table, kajog-kawef:
PRIORITIES = {
    "kelox": 870,
    "kasix": 89,
    "eliax": 988,
}

# Break-Glass Access: Webhook Retry Semantics

Quillgate retries failed webhook deliveries five times with exponential backoff, capping at fifteen minutes. If a partner endpoint stays down past the cap, deliveries park in the holdback queue. Draining that queue requires break-glass access to the Marrow console, which unlocks with the recovery passphrase below.

unlock words, kahog-hahop: zordor-casael-jorath-druius-kasok

## Ticket: Formula sandbox losing DB connections

User-supplied formulas run inside the Greywall sandbox with outbound network blocked. Since the last policy update, the evaluator's results writer intermittently fails to connect, suggesting the egress allowlist no longer covers the results database. Please review whether the sandbox policy should permit this destination. The writer connects using the string below.

primary connection of tawif-yajeg = postgresql://rusiel_svc:G879q9cx6GsSvj@db-dd9f.norvagrid.internal:5432/casath